What are the top trade shows in Frozen Sauces?
Key trade shows for the Frozen Sauces industry include SIAL Paris, Anuga in Germany, and Alimentaria in Spain. These events are essential for buyers and suppliers to network, discover new products, and explore market trends within the culinary world. What are the top certificates in Frozen Sauces?
In the Frozen Sauces industry, quality and safety certifications are vital. The top certificates include IFS, Organic, BRCGS, and Vegan certifications. These credentials assure buyers of the product's quality and compliance with international standards. IFS and BRCGS focus on food safety and quality management systems, while Organic and Vegan certifications cater to the growing demand for environmentally friendly and ethically produced goods. What are the minimum order quantities in Frozen Sauces?
Minimum order quantities (MOQs) in the Frozen Sauces industry vary by product type. For branded Frozen Sauces, MOQs typically range from 1000 to 3000 units. In contrast, private label orders often require larger quantities, ranging from 10000 to 50000 units. These MOQs are important for professional buyers looking to make wholesale purchases and secure competitive pricing.
